Transaction 084063e2c475c24bef8f347822e3cbedc54ef43fff40cb300a33e0f22dc32a1e

1 Input
2 Outputs
  • 084063e2c475c24bef8f347822e3cbedc54ef43fff40cb300a33e0f22dc32a1e:0
  • value  292859
    address  1DfDKK4SxfDFrof8jgqkhRJrVva2sKYnHt
  • 084063e2c475c24bef8f347822e3cbedc54ef43fff40cb300a33e0f22dc32a1e:1
  • value  1696699
    address  1PccFwxYp2Gme7mKuVj89JTyW9GdXfeD7X